Unveiling Affordability:

  • Market Snapshot: The median home price in Palm Springs sits at
    $650,000 (Redfin, March 2024)
    $799,000 (Movoto, March 2024)
  • While prices hold steady, some popular vacation rental neighborhoods have seen slight dips. It's still a seller's market in some neighborhoods, so be prepared for some competition.
  • Budget-Conscious Options: Looking for a more affordable entry point? Explore Desert Hot Springs, Indio, or other east valley communities. Cathedral City and Palm Desert also offer more budget-friendly options.

The following is a summary of median home prices in the Coachella Valley: Based on Redfin calculations of home data from MLS and/or public records. 

Cathedral City:  $525,000

Desert Hot Springs:  $402,500

Indio:  $559,000

La Quinta:  $827,500

Palm Springs:  $650,000

Palm Desert:  $610,000

Rancho Mirage:  $972,500

Considering a Commute?)

(Traffic congestion can significantly impact travel times, especially in Los Angeles.  Be sure to check live traffic conditions before your trip for the most accurate estimate.)

Palm Springs offers a relaxed pace, but commuting to major hubs and attractions is possible:

  • Palm Springs to Riverside: The distance from Palm Springs, CA to Riverside, CA is  53.9 miles along I-10 W and CA-60 W/Moreno Valley Fwy according to Google Maps. It will take about 1 hour 1 minute to get there by car. 
  • Palm Springs to Downtown Los Angeles: 107.3 miles via CA-111 N and I-10 W. This route is estimated to take approximately 1 hour and 53 minutes by car according to Google Maps.  Traffic congestion can significantly impact travel times, especially in Los Angeles.  Be sure to check live traffic conditions before your trip for the most accurate estimate. 
  • Palm Springs to Joshua Tree:  The distance from Palm Springs to the Joshua Tree National Park West Entrance is approximately 24 miles via CA-62 E. This route should take about 45 minutes to drive according to Google Maps 
  • Palm Springs to Downtown San Diego: 123.6 miles via I-10 W. This route is estimated to take approximately 2 hours and 11 minutes by car according to Google Maps 
  • Palm Springs to the closest beach:  The closest beach to Palm Springs is likely Newport Beach, which is 106 miles away. It should take about 1 hour and 55 minutes to get there by car. 
  • Palm Springs to Mountain High Resort: This popular resort in the San Gabriel Mountains is 102 miles away from Palm Springs.  It should take approximately 1 hour and 57 minutes to get there by car 

Take Flight from Palm Springs: Nonstop Flight Times to Major Cities

Dreaming of a getaway beyond the desert? Palm Springs International Airport (PSP) offers convenient nonstop flights to several major cities, making your escape plans a breeze. Here's a quick rundown of how long it takes to fly nonstop from Palm Springs to some popular destinations:

  • Vancouver, BC (YVR): Soak up the beauty of Canada's West Coast in about 2 hours and 45 minutes.
  • Seattle, WA (SEA): Explore the Emerald City in approximately 2 hours and 15 minutes.
  • San Francisco, CA (SFO or OAK): Head north for the Golden Gate Bridge in under an hour, with a typical nonstop flight time of 55 minutes to 1 hour.
  • New York, NY (JFK, LGA, or EWR): Dive into the energy of the Big Apple in 4 hours and 45 minutes to 5 hours and 15 minutes nonstop.
  • Chicago, IL (ORD or MDW): Experience the Windy City's iconic architecture in 3 hours and 45 minutes to 4 hours nonstop.

Remember: These are just estimated flight times, and the actual duration can vary depending on factors like wind speed, airline, and specific flight route.  Always check with your chosen airline for the most up-to-date information on your specific flight.
